Awesome weekend!

Katana had a great weekend! On Saturday we hunted 2 different fields. The first one she had 3 spectacular flights in, but was trying to get the rabbits from behind instead of above and kept getting hung up in the broom weed. She did take 3 rats in this field which she transferred off of nicely and did not carry (thank goodness!!) The second field we flushed a rabbit out of a large brush pile that made the mistake of heading straight out into the open. Katana narrowed in quickly from her vantage point in a nearby tree and slammed the rabbit with some gusto. She also pulled 3 small mice out of this field. Today we hit 3 different fields. In the first field she had some spectacular chases, but the cover was so thick that she lost sight of the rabbits before making in on them. In the second field, she took a nice high perch atop a building and slammed through some thick cover to snag a rat. Other than that we did not see much. The last field she took 3 mice and a large rabbit just as it tried to make into a brush pile. We also took our 3 mos English Pointers out hunting with her this weekend, and they did great. They stayed close to me the entire time and also showed Krys there was a rat hiding under a rock. They are going to work out great and can't wait to see them in action next season!
